Output 4ae66d911399a94a6ce20dfb6c3678b03dfcf90e3a02d97bd7af462f0f4e4675:7

value
1894152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81c364e9ee1ca33df2650afd4db60fda75ee81ba OP_EQUALVERIFY OP_CHECKSIG
address
1Cq8EyRP3MGG86cTcpAyKGqLzLuMHAp8sq
transaction
4ae66d911399a94a6ce20dfb6c3678b03dfcf90e3a02d97bd7af462f0f4e4675
spent
true